1,337,965,675,680,933 is an odd composite number composed of five prime numbers multiplied together.

What does the number 1337965675680933 look like?

This visualization shows the relationship between its 5 prime factors (large circles) and 270 divisors.

1337965675680933 is an odd compos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of two hundred seventy divisors.

Prime factorization of 1337965675680933:

34 × 13 × 172 × 612 × 10872

(3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 13 × 17 × 17 × 61 × 61 × 1087 × 1087)
